Transaction Speed and Efficiency

Transaction speed is a key performance factor for Bitcoin payment gateways, shaping customer satisfaction, operational workflows, and overall business outcomes. Unlike traditional payment systems, Bitcoin transaction times depend on network conditions, making it essential to understand and measure speed. Let's break down how transaction speed impacts businesses and how it can be optimized.

How Transaction Speed Impacts Business

Customer experience: In e-commerce, customers expect payments to process instantly. However, Bitcoin transactions often take 10–60 minutes for blockchain confirmation. This delay can frustrate customers, leading to abandoned purchases or increased support inquiries, which in turn drive up costs and cause missed revenue opportunities.

Cash flow and operational efficiency: Delayed confirmations can disrupt cash flow and create bottlenecks in processing. For example, a retailer handling $100,000 in daily Bitcoin payments might face liquidity challenges if transactions frequently take longer than expected. These delays can also burden support and reconciliation teams, especially during high-volume sales periods.

Competitive disadvantage: In industries where speed is critical, slow transaction times can push customers toward faster alternatives, putting businesses at a disadvantage.

How to Measure Transaction Speed

To manage and improve transaction speed, businesses should track these key metrics:

  • Average confirmation time: This measures the time from payment initiation to full blockchain confirmation, offering a baseline for performance evaluation.
  • Median confirmation time: Unlike averages, this metric provides a clearer picture of typical transaction times by excluding outliers, helping businesses understand the standard customer experience.
  • Peak load performance: Analyzing transaction speeds during high-demand periods, such as sales events or market volatility, reveals how well the gateway handles stress.
  • Network fee correlation: Tracking how transaction fees affect confirmation times helps businesses strike a balance between cost and speed, optimizing fee strategies.
  • Time-to-first-confirmation: This metric highlights when a transaction first appears on the blockchain, allowing businesses to provide customers with immediate payment acknowledgments, even before full confirmation.

Success Rate and Reliability

The success rate of payments plays a pivotal role in shaping both revenue and customer loyalty. While transaction speed often grabs the spotlight, reliability is just as critical. After all, a gateway that processes payments quickly but fails frequently can cause major headaches for businesses and customers alike.

What Is Payment Success Rate?

Payment success rate measures the percentage of transactions that go through without any errors. For Bitcoin payment gateways, this metric is especially tricky because of blockchain-specific challenges.

Let’s break it down: A 95% success rate means 1 in 20 transactions fails. For a business handling 10,000 Bitcoin transactions a month, that’s 500 failed payments. If the average transaction value is $150, those failures could add up to a significant revenue loss.

But it’s not just about the money. Bitcoin gateways face hurdles like network congestion, inadequate transaction fees, and wallet compatibility issues. These problems don’t just disrupt sales - they also frustrate customers, increase support requests, and hurt retention.

How to Monitor Reliability

Keeping an eye on reliability requires more than just tracking uptime. For Bitcoin payment gateways, the decentralized nature of blockchain networks brings unique challenges. Here are some strategies to stay ahead:

  • Analyze error codes: Dive into specific errors like network timeouts, insufficient fees, or invalid wallet addresses. This helps pinpoint whether the problem lies with gateway infrastructure, blockchain conditions, or user actions.
  • Monitor transactions in real time: Keep tabs on pending transactions and average confirmation times. This can help spot network congestion or other issues before they escalate.
  • Run automated health checks: Regularly test Bitcoin node connectivity, fee estimation algorithms, and wallet integration endpoints. This proactive approach can catch potential problems early.
  • Review historical trends: Look at success rates under different market conditions or after system updates. Identifying patterns can guide improvements and boost reliability over time.

Scalability and Integration Flexibility

For enterprise Bitcoin payment gateways, the ability to handle increasing transaction volumes and integrate effortlessly with existing systems is essential for ensuring smooth, long-term growth without interruptions.

How to Evaluate Scalability Metrics

When assessing scalability, a few key metrics stand out:

  • Concurrent transaction capacity: This measures how many transactions the system can handle at the same time without slowing down. Enterprise-grade gateways must be able to process thousands of simultaneous transactions to meet demand.
  • System uptime: Reliability is critical. Gateways should aim for at least 99.9% uptime, as any downtime - especially during busy periods - can lead to lost revenue and unhappy customers.
  • Response time under load: Even during peak transaction volumes, the system should respond within 2 seconds. Gateways that maintain this speed ensure a smooth experience for users, even when demand surges.
  • Auto-scaling capabilities: The ability to automatically adjust to sudden spikes in traffic is crucial. For example, during major sales or promotional events, auto-scaling prevents system overload and ensures uninterrupted operations.

Scalability is most effective when paired with seamless integration, allowing the gateway to function smoothly across all platforms and systems.

Integration with Enterprise Systems

Efficient integration with existing enterprise systems not only enhances operational efficiency but also minimizes implementation costs. For instance:

  • ERP system compatibility: This ensures transaction data integrates seamlessly into financial reporting and inventory management workflows.
  • CRM integration: By linking payment data with customer profiles, businesses can track customer payment preferences and transaction histories within their existing processes.
  • Accounting system synchronization: Automated updates simplify tax reporting, audits, and overall financial management.

An API-first development approach further enhances integration. By offering secure API credentials, robust SDKs, and comprehensive exchange APIs, payment gateways enable effortless third-party connections. This approach also supports automated reconciliation and real-time financial reporting, streamlining operations across the board.
